IIHS Reveals What's Fueling The Spike In DUI Fatalities

It turns out the pandemic didn't just bring us sourdough bread obsessions and endless Zoom calls. According to a recent study by the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S), it also fueled a serious"and unexpected"spike in deadly drunk-driving crashes.
